Earlier today, Munenori Kawasaki, aka “Energy Boy,” resigned with the Toronto Blue Jays on a minor league deal with an invite to Spring Training. This seems like an appropriate time to relive one of the best moments of the 2013 baseball season.
Let’s Relive Munenori Kawasaki’s Jubilant Post-game Interview
